This iconic oceanfront gem boasts arguably the best ocean views on the Westside. Jim Charlton AIA, an apprentice of Frank Lloyd Wright and who also worked with John Lautner, designed this mid-century modern stunner. This bright and airy home offers 3 bedrooms, 2.5 bathrooms, wall-to-walls of glass and impeccable design throughout. The open floor-plan features the sizeable living room with a fireplac, dining area and the well-appointed kitchen with a breakfast bar. Panoramic sliding glass doors span the main living space and seamlessly open onto the covered balcony that showcases breathtaking coastline views. The main level provides two bedrooms, including the Primary Suite with views up and down the coast, a large walk-in closet and bathroom with a dual-vanity.
Downstairs you will find an additional ocean view bedroom, bathroom, massive storage room and expansive covered patio that can potentially be enclosed to add additional square footage. A two-car garage with direct entry and gated driveway with additional space for guest parking completes this rare home. Immediate beach access is provided by an adjacent staircase and tunnel that lead you to the sand, boardwalk, surf and the world famous State Beach volleyball courts in front.
